Gray Gutted

Level 7 : 500/1,000, 100 ante
Jason Gray
Jason Gray

Jason Gray, who was crippled earlier in the night when his aces fell to Asa Smith's kings, just got his stack all in on the turn against the same opponent. The board read {8-Diamonds}{7-Diamonds}{7-Spades}{4-Diamonds} and the following cards were turned up:

Gray: {a-Diamonds}{10-Diamonds}
Smith: {8-Clubs}{7-Hearts}

Gray had turned a flush, but he was drawing dead as Smith had flopped a full house. The meaningless {6-Spades} was put out on the river for good measure and Gray exited the tournament area.
